Overview: Singapore Pools 4D

Singapore Pools is the only government-authorized lottery operator in Singapore. It has been running since 1968 and operates under strict regulatory oversight by the Tote Board. Key characteristics include:

  • Draws held on Wednesday, Saturday, and Sunday.
  • Players choose a 4-digit number from 0000–9999.
  • Results are publicly broadcast and available on the official website.
  • Bets can be placed at authorized outlets or via the official app (for registered users).
  • Prize claims must be made within 90 days of the draw date.

Overview: Magnum 4D (Malaysia)

Magnum Corporation is one of Malaysia's oldest and most recognized lottery companies, licensed under the Malaysian government. It operates similarly to Singapore Pools but has its own prize structure and market features:

  • Draws also held on Wednesday, Saturday, and Sunday.
  • Offers standard Big and Small bets, plus additional options like 4D Jackpot and 4D Life.
  • Results published on the official Magnum website and through authorized dealers.
  • Prize collection window is typically 180 days from the draw date.
  • Magnum also offers special draws during festive seasons.

What Makes Each Market Unique?

Singapore Pools: Simplicity and Tight Regulation

Singapore Pools focuses on a clean, transparent experience. With fewer bet variants, it's an excellent starting point for new players. The regulatory environment is among the strictest in the world, which provides strong player protection.

Magnum 4D: More Variety and Larger Jackpots

Magnum differentiates itself with 4D Jackpot — a progressive jackpot variant where players pick two 4D numbers per ticket for a chance at a larger pooled prize. The 4D Life variant offers monthly payouts for top prize winners rather than a lump sum, appealing to players who prefer steady income.
